Introduction of Steel Roof Covering
Metal roof has actually gained popularity in the last few years because of its sturdiness and visual allure. When you pick steel roof, you're selecting a material that can stand up to rough weather conditions, consisting of hefty rainfall, snow, and high winds.
Unlike traditional roof shingles, metal roofs can last 40 to 70 years with marginal maintenance, making them a long-term financial investment.
Another advantage of metal roof is its power performance. You'll locate that several metal roof coverings are developed to reflect solar heat, which can help in reducing your cooling costs throughout warm summer season.
Plus, steel roofing systems are often made from recycled materials, which appeals to ecologically aware house owners.
In terms of layout, metal roof can be found in various designs, colors, and surfaces, allowing you to tailor your home's look. Whether you prefer a streamlined contemporary look or a rustic beauty, you'll have choices to match your vision.
Ultimately, metal roofing is resistant to insects and rot, providing you peace of mind that your roof covering will stay intact over the years.
With all these benefits, it's no wonder numerous home owners are making the switch to steel roof covering.

Trick Comparisons and Factors To Consider
Choosing in between metal and tile roof covering includes several crucial contrasts and factors to consider that can substantially affect your choice.
Initially, think of toughness. Steel roofs can last 40 to 70 years, while asphalt roof shingles usually last 15 to 30 years. This longevity means that although steel may have a greater ahead of time expense, it might conserve you cash over time.
Next, think about upkeep. Steel roof coverings require much less maintenance, withstanding mold and mold, while tiles could require much more frequent inspections and repairs.
Climate resistance is an additional essential variable. Steel roofings deal with harsh weather condition well, consisting of hefty rainfall and snow, whereas roof shingles can be susceptible to wind damage.
Aesthetic appeals additionally contribute. Tiles provide a standard appearance that many home owners like, while steel roof covering can be found in numerous designs and colors, permitting more personalization.
Lastly, examine insulation and energy performance. Steel roofing systems reflect warmth, maintaining your home cooler, while tiles may soak up extra warmth, affecting your power costs.
Inevitably, weigh these aspects against your spending plan, regional environment, and personal preferences to make the very best roof covering selection for your home.
